Output c59d023257681c2fb972bcb7abf931646cef476e98b788d0b8022bfe93801421:1

value
1429808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c03526e80816d565e53f976c6605fc52650da4f OP_EQUAL
address
3LHjkVaxgrKLd6hQnv3e9UGrJThj4Bb7Dq
transaction
c59d023257681c2fb972bcb7abf931646cef476e98b788d0b8022bfe93801421
spent
true